<p>What Is a Crypto Casino?</p>

<hr>

<p>A crypto casino is an online gaming site that lets gamers money their accounts and withdraw winnings using cryptocurrencies rather of traditional fiat currencies. These platforms typically operate on a combination of blockchain‑based smart agreements and centralized backend systems. While some operators completely decentralize the betting engine, the majority of depend on a hybrid model where the front‑end utilizes crypto wallets and the back‑end uses standard casino software application to ensure game fairness and regulatory compliance.</p>

<p>The core appeal depends on the underlying blockchain journal, which tape-records every bet, deposit, and withdrawal in a transparent, tamper‑proof manner. This openness can be enhanced by provably‑fair algorithms, allowing gamers to confirm the randomness of each video game result individually.</p>
<ul><li>* *</li></ul>

<p>How Crypto Casinos Operate</p>

<hr>
<ol><li><strong>Wallet Integration</strong>-– Players create a web‑based or mobile wallet (e.g., Trust Wallet, MetaMask) and connect it to the casino&#39;s deposit address.</li>
<li><strong>Deposit Process</strong>-– The player starts a transfer from their individual wallet to the casino&#39;s hot or cold wallet. The deal is verified on the particular blockchain, normally within minutes.</li>
<li><strong>Bet Placement</strong>-– Once the deposit is credited, the player can bet on slots, table video games, or live dealer titles. The software transforms the crypto balance into virtual credits (typically denominated in the picked cryptocurrency).</li>
<li><strong>Payouts</strong>-– Winning bets are transformed back to the initial cryptocurrency at the existing exchange rate and moved to the gamer&#39;s wallet.</li></ol>

<p>Most crypto casinos likewise provide instant‑play variations of timeless casino video games, and some offer proprietary tokens that unlock unique bonuses or loyalty programs.</p>

<p>1. How Cryptocurrency Functions in Online Casinos</p>

<hr>

<p>In a standard online casino, gamers generally utilize fiat techniques (credit cards, e‑wallets, bank transfers) to fill their accounts. When crypto gets in the formula, the process follows a somewhat various flow:</p>
<ol><li><strong>Wallet Creation:</strong> The gamer develops a digital wallet that supports the selected cryptocurrency.</li>
<li><strong>Deposit:</strong> The casino creates a distinct address or QR code. The player transfers the preferred amount from their wallet to the casino&#39;s address. The deal is tape-recorded on the blockchain and normally verified within minutes, depending upon the network&#39;s blockage.</li>
<li><strong>Betting:</strong> The transferred amount is transformed (at the dominating exchange rate) into the casino&#39;s internal credit system, typically denominated in the site&#39;s own virtual tokens or directly in the crypto of choice.</li>
<li><strong>Withdrawals:</strong> When a gamer demands a payment, the casino sends out the crypto from its hot or cold wallet to the player&#39;s address. Blockchain verifications are needed before the funds become spendable.</li></ol>

<p>Due to the fact that each transfer is logged on a public journal, gamers can validate transactions individually, adding a layer of transparency that numerous conventional payment approaches lack.</p>

<p>6. Regulative Landscape and Future Outlook</p>

<hr>

<p>Across the globe, regulators are still forming the legal framework for crypto betting. Some jurisdictions, such as the United Kingdom and specific EU countries, deal with crypto‑based wagers likewise to fiat bets— needing operators to obtain a gambling license and impose player‑protection steps. Others, like the United States, have a fragmented method, with some states permitting online betting while others impose stringent bans.</p>

<p>Looking ahead, several patterns are likely to influence the sector:</p>
<ul><li><strong>Central Bank Digital Currencies (CBDCs):</strong> As governments introduce their own digital currencies, gambling establishments might incorporate these for faster settlement.</li>
<li><strong>Boosted DeFi Integration:</strong> Decentralized financing procedures might allow immediate token swaps directly within the gaming platform, reducing the need for external exchanges.</li>

<li><p><strong>Stricter AML/KYC Standards:</strong> Expect more robust identity‑verification processes, even for crypto deals, to fight cash laundering.</p></li>
